#38cc39 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#38cc39 is composed of 22% red, 80% green and 22.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 72.1%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 120.4 degrees, a saturation of 59.2% and a lightness of 51%. #38cc39 color hex could be obtained by blending #70ff72 with #009900.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

#38cc39 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#38cc39 has RGB values of R:56, G:204, B:57 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0, Y:0.72,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 3722297.
